Monolithic Power Systems (MPS) MagAlpha MAQ850 8-Bit Angle Encoders
Monolithic Power Systems (MPS) MagAlpha MAQ850 8-Bit Angle Encoders are designed to replace analogic potentiometers or rotary switches. These encoders are for slow operation in Human-Machine Interfaces (HMIs) and manual controls with a rotating speed below 200rpm. The sensor detects the absolute angular position of a permanent magnet attached to a rotating shaft and outputs a Pulse-Width Modulation (PWM) waveform. These encoders feature configurable magnetic field strength thresholds, which allow for the implementation of a push or pull button function.The MAQ850 8-Bit encoders on-chip Non-Volatile Memory (NVM) stores configurable parameters, such as the reference zero angle position and magnetic field detection threshold. These encoders are available in QFN-16 (3mm x 3mm) package and are AEC-Q100 qualified. Typical applications include rotary knob control interfaces, manual controls, encoders, automotive, and white goods.
Features
- 8-Bit resolution absolute angle encoder
- Contactless sensing for long life with no wear
- Serial Peripheral Interface (SPI) for chip configuration
- Configurable magnetic field strength detection for push/pull button detection
- Pulse-Width Modulation (PWM) output
- Available in a QFN-16 (3mm x 3mm) package
- AEC-Q100 grade 1 qualified
Specifications
- 3 to 3.6V supply voltage range
- 10.2mA to 13.8mA supply current range
- 60mT (typical) applied magnetic field
- -40°C to 125°C operating temperature range
